Swiftui tooltip example github. See the animation below for more details.

Bombshell's boobs pop out in a race car
Swiftui tooltip example github. import SwiftUI struct Tooltip: NSViewRepresentable {. "State-driven": Most other initializers and methods do take a binding, which means you can mutate state in your domain to tell SwiftUI when it should activate or deactivate navigation. Nov 8, 2020 · CalendarKit supports localization and uses iOS default locale to display month and day names. roundedBorder. To use SwiftOpenAI safely without hardcoding your API key, follow these steps: Create a . Contributing to the 7. Usage Example 1 Easy Tooltip for your SwiftUI Project. @available(OSX 10. This tutorial shows how to create a chat application that is fully functional and ready for you to build on using SwiftUI - GetStream/swiftui-chat-tutorial SwiftUI. ForEach. (Foods App) SwiftUI Multiplatform & Navigation Sample App Introduction. A tag already exists with the provided branch name. Currently supported gestures are: DoubleTap and LongPress. For example, to setup the “Save as favorite” tip, you can create a struct that conforms to the Tip protocol like Examples of this are the initializers on TabView and NavigationLink that do not take a binding. Learn how the UI elements can be integrated into apps. @State private var viewState = CGSize(width: 0, height: screenHeight) @State private var MainviewState = CGSize. return UIScreen. SwiftWebUI - A demo implementation of SwiftUI The original content was written in VStack. As a complete and independent language, Swift Sep 28, 2021 · SwiftUI-MVVM. You can add a line chart with the following code: LineChartView( data: [8,23,54,32,12,37,7,23,43], title: "Title", legend: "Legendary") // legend is optional. Sep 5, 2023 · To create a tip using the TipKit framework, you need to adopt the Tip protocol to configure the content of the tip. One of the biggest idea for having MVVM is that most of data flow can be testable. Legacy branches (5. swift. Example of how to combine SwiftUI Router and SwiftUI's builtin TabView. This book covers the following exciting features: Start with a quick recap of the UI essentials in Swift and Swift basics. But here is a solution also for this: import SwiftUI. Solve issue when you drop an item outside the view and view is not reset. onSelect { print ( " clicked! . Create React tooltips similar to those used by Material-UI. MKToolTip is a customizable tooltip view written in Swift that can be used as a informative tip inside your both Swift and Objective-C projects. All you need to do is follow the below steps. Add data-tooltip-id="<tooltip id>" and data-tooltip-content="<your placeholder Otherwise it has the usual view model responsibilities, i. Add this topic to your repo. plist file: Add a new . SwiftUI-Circular. 5: Released by Apple during WWDC 2019, SwiftUI provides an innovative and exceptionally simple way to build user interfaces for all Apple platforms with the power of Swift. The goal is to build up a collection of SwiftUI projects that do one job and do it well, all updated for the latest versions Add this topic to your repo. SwiftUI Chat App example for the Stream tutorial. swift apple tooltip swiftui swift5. stripe-swiftui. More than 100 million people use GitHub to discover, fork, and contribute to over 420 million projects. bounds. 15, *) public extension View {. Enter following url when adding it to your project package dependencies: Swift + SwiftUI codebase containing real world examples (CRUD, auth, advanced patterns, etc) that adheres to the RealWorld spec and API. plist file to your project, e. fontDesign(. Swift is a high-performance system programming language. A sample SwiftUI List backed by a FetchedResultsController struct NoteList : View { @ ObjectBinding var resultsController = FetchedResultsController ( with : FetchRequest ( for : Note . Add your API Key: Inside Config. init ( identifier: "de")) The font design can be configured by using the fontDesign modifier. " Learn more. FloatingButton - Floating button menu. Examples of working with CoreData persistence, networking, dependency injection, unit testing, and more. , Config. g. In this blog post, I will share my An example of importing and exporting files using SwiftUI - acwright/ImportExport Sample code: To view the WinUI controls in an interactive format, check out the Xaml Controls Gallery (for WinUI 2) and the WinUI 3 Controls Gallery: Get the XAML Controls Gallery app from the Microsoft Store or get the source code on GitHub; Get the WinUI 3 Controls Gallery app from the Microsoft Store or get the source code on GitHub Fully-customizable SwiftUI date/time picker dialog. height. The Swift Package Manager is a tool for automating the distribution of Swift code and is integrated into the swift compiler. CalendarView() . You signed in with another tab or window. At the same time, this repository shows how easy it is to create unnecessary entities in a simple application )) Easy Tooltip for your SwiftUI Project. Enter following url when adding it to your project package dependencies: One of the biggest idea for having MVVM is that most of data flow can be testable. Requirements iOS 9. macOS Specific Features. let view = NSView() view. The steps needed for customizations are as follows: Create a new CalendarStyle object (or copy existing one) Jun 16, 2023 · For example, this creates a text field with the constant string “Hello”: TextField("Example placeholder", text: . Build commands (master, 7. environment( \. Triangle Swapping Dots. To associate your repository with the swiftui-tutorials topic, visit your repo's landing page and select "manage topics. We are also publishing blog articles that explain many of these examples in detail, you can read them on Nil Coalescing Blog. SimpleScores is a score tracker. Horizontal Swapping Dots. foo = foo. Enter following url when adding it to your project package dependencies: SwiftUI sample app using Clean Architecture. constant("Hello")) . When adding tooltips to a UIView that has subviews with tooltips, make sure to use a different gesture for the superview. Includes DIContainer, FlowCoordinator, DTO, Response Caching and one of the views in SwiftUI - GitHub - kudoleh/iOS-Clean-Architecture-MVVM: Template iOS app using Clean Architecture and MVVM. Supports iOS and macOS. GitHub is where people build software. 2 . e. SwiftUI Tooltip . secondary: text_sep: Distance in px between each line: Real-1 (default spacing) text_max_width: Row max width before going on a newline: Real-1 (no newlines by default) padding_horizontal OpenSwiftUI is an open source implementation of Apple's SwiftUI. How to Use. Each tooltip is associated with a specific view (repeatView, weightView, and infoView) and displays localized text ("repeat_tooltip", "weight_tooltip", and "info_tooltip"). NSToolbar - This is implemented entirely in the AppDelegate, and uses standard Cocoa code which interfaces with the SwiftUI views. Specify custom views (UIView or SwiftUI View) to overlay parts of the calendar, enabling features like tooltips; Specify custom views (UIView or SwiftUI View) for month background decorations (colors, grids, etc. Code. ###Swift Package Manager. ) Specify custom views (UIView or SwiftUI View) for day background decorations (colors, patterns, etc. You can add this package on Xcode. Customizable cancelling. This package provides you with an easy way to show tooltips over any SwiftUI view, since Apple does not provide one. Usage example (see demo or read the documentation for more details): let menu = NSMenu { MenuItem ( " Click me " ) . SimpleNotes is a macOS menu bar notes app. Specify valid range of selectable dates. And this creates a slider with a constant value of 0. After step 2 is a bit where I got lost so I'm hoping this sample project will help. Harvest-SwiftUI-Gallery - Gallery App for Harvest (Elm Architecture + Optics) + SwiftUI + Combine. Topics Mar 16, 2021 · on Mar 16, 2021. This code initializes a ToolTipHandler object with a collection of tooltips and presents the tooltips. Contribute to suatkarakusoglu/tooltips development by creating an account on GitHub. func makeNSView(context: NSViewRepresentableContext<Tooltip>) -> NSView {. We suggest you do it on your src/index. Tips consist of a title and a short description. Swift. Dec 12, 2019 · It'll be helpful to add a swiftUI example that uses the standard FirebaseUI. Getting started . If you have project, make a pull request or create issue with link to repo. Selected date binding. onDrop. Tooltips and hacks about programming. Jul 21, 2023 · In iOS development, the Swift Charts framework provides a powerful and user-friendly solution for creating stunning charts and graphs in SwiftUI. Data binding in view layer by SwiftUI is awesome. As a bonus, there's an extension that loads GIFs into UIImages, as well as a UIKIt-compatible UIGIFImage class. Three Progress Dots. More than 100 million people use GitHub to discover, fork, and contribute to over 330 million projects. A notes app written in >100 lines of swift using SwiftUI. Once you configured the animations, a good idea would be to make these preferences global, for all future instances of EasyTipView by assigning it to EasyTipView. Enter following url when adding it to your project package dependencies: Jun 12, 2023 · Integrating the project is simple. textFieldStyle(. Setup (and development basics) Development workflow. It brings all your favorite features from SDWebImage, like async image loading, memory/disk caching, animated image playback and performances. Include Layout, UI, Animations, Gestures, Draw and Data. Features Line chart is interactive, so you can drag across to reveal the data points. The framework provide the different View structs, which API match the SwiftUI framework guideline. SwiftUIで簡単なサンプルアプリを作ってみた. Due to the interest of time the examples were only made and tested on iOS and macOS. Turn drop shadow off by adding to the Initialiser: dropShadow: false. Lightweight SwiftUI component for rendering GIFs from data or assets, with no external dependencies. Contribute to quassum/SwiftUI-Tooltip development by creating an account on GitHub. init( database: AppDatabase, foo: Foo) { self. While the article introduces the different techniques and components of our approach to the Coordinator Pattern in SwiftUI on a general level, the Recipes App acts as a demonstration and can be used as a starting point to experimenting with it. UIKit. Oct 30, 2020 · Development process. Issues. [Demo] RealWorld This codebase was created to demonstrate a fully fledged application for iOS/macOS/iPadOS built with [Swift UI] including CRUD operations, authentication, routing, pagination, and more. Import react-tooltip after installation. MediaPicker - Customizable media picker. return view. ForEach not SwiftUI. Once you have your Swift package set up, adding LottieUI as a dependency is as easy as adding it to the dependencies value of your Package. The ToolTipHandler provides functionality for managing and Once the dataSource is set up, you can start displaying the coach marks. This example shows how to: Implement reorder items in LazyVStack. I've added several things to make the macOS app stand out: Double click - You can double click on a post to open a new window for the detail view. Easy Tooltip for your SwiftUI Project. plist, add a new row with the Key OpenAI_API_Key and paste your API key in the Value field. Jan 1, 2023 · SwiftUI Tooltip. self. Whereas SwiftUI's ForEach needs to respond to dynamically changing data at any time during execution, MacMenuBar's ForEach only needs to do that when the user opens its 1 Creating and Combining Views. Here are few examples: Styles. UI control + speech recognition functionality in just several lines of code. UnsplashSwiftUI. You switched accounts on another tab or window. func tooltip(_ toolTip: String) -> some View {. ConcentricOnboarding - Animated onboarding flow. SwiftUI Code Examples. However, this project has view model layer to make it testable as much as possible. processing the data for the view and providing functions to modify the data. You signed out in another tab or window. 0%. SwiftUI does not provide an easy way to show tooltips over exiting views, so we created one!The tooltip provideded by this package allows you to put any View you want into the tooltip and position it on any side of the other View. Reload to refresh your session. GitHub community articles Repositories. 🚀 SwiftUI Sliders with custom styles Topics macos swift swift-library ios apple xcode tvos watchos swift-package sliders swiftui swiftui-example Nov 26, 2023 · SwiftUI Tooltips with TipKit (Popover & Inline Tips) - GitHub - JawadAliPK/Tooltips-with-TipKit: SwiftUI Tooltips with TipKit (Popover & Inline Tips) AnimatedTabBar - A tabbar with number of preset animations. - nalexn/clean-architecture-swiftui Sep 6, 2022 · SwiftUI Drag and Drop Example. To associate your repository with the todolist topic, visit your repo's landing page and select "manage topics. You also want your SwiftUI previews to display the expected values without having to run them. TooltipView. This idea can be achieved by Flux or Redux as well, but I chose MVVM first because it’s handy.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. GitHub Gist: instantly share code, notes, and snippets. globalPreferences. Examples projects using SwiftUI & Combine. For more animations, checkout the example project. Star 174. CalendarKit's look can be easily customized. This blog post will give you an introduction to SwiftCharts and show you how to create visually appealing and informative charts in your iOS and macOS apps. SDWebImageSwiftUI is a SwiftUI image loading framework, which based on SDWebImage. Need to updateNSView in case we toggle the state of tooltip. onDrag, . js or equivalent file. See projects files in Files & Other Projects folders. Supports all SwiftUI DatePicker styles - default, compact, wheel and graphical. You can just import TooltipKitSwiftUI to use the package. You will also want to follow the steps listed on adding MSAL to your project listed here. or if you want to still use the name ReactTooltip as V4: import { Tooltip as ReactTooltip } from 'react-tooltip'. Choose which picker component to display - date, time or both. Please give my project a star. This example app is part of our blog article How to Use the Coordinator Pattern in SwiftUI. To associate your repository with the swiftui-tooltip Mar 1, 2022 · The Swift Package Manager is a tool for automating the distribution of Swift code and is integrated into the swift compiler. Triangle Rotating Dots. database = database. Using local (unpublished) version of the lib with a local React app. 0 branch. See documentation. SwiftSpeech is a wrapper for Apple's Speech framework with deep SwiftUI and Combine integration. Sample iOS project built by SwiftUI + MVVM and Combine framework using GitHub API. A function builder for NSMenus, similar in spirit to SwiftUI’s ViewBuilder. SwiftUI Tooltip Description . Enter following url when adding it to your project package dependencies: Easy Tooltip for your SwiftUI Project. Here's skeleton code that works for me: return UIScreen. To associate your repository with the swiftui-example topic, visit your repo's landing page and select "manage topics. The workaround is to use a overplayed old NSView import SwiftUI. Mar 11, 2020 · If you support macOS 10. Enter following url when adding it to your project package dependencies: You signed in with another tab or window. Three Bounce Dot. 1 SwiftUI Router is available on iOS (and iPadOS), macOS, tvOS and watchOS. Pull requests. sorted ( by : \ . lastModificationDate , ascending : false ) ) var body : some View { NavigationView { List { ForEach ( resultsController . The project is for the following purposes: Build GUI app on non-Apple platform (eg. let tooltip: String func makeNSView ( context: NSViewRepresentableContext<Tooltip>) -> NSView {. locale, . 3 . jasudev / AxisTooltip. I am styling the trigger based on data-state="open" to signal the open state to the user. 包含SwiftUI绝大数控件示例、iOS常用框架示例. Linux & Windows) Diagnose and debug SwiftUI issues on Apple platform. help("this is tooltip") In swiftUI 1 there is really no native way to create a tooltip. CalendarView uses the calendar, time zone and locale from the environment. NotesApp. SwiftUI style reactive APIs and Combine support. This package provides you with an easy way to show a tooltip like a chat bublle or a balloon. struct Config { static var openAIKey: String { get {. Customize the SwiftUI . First day of the week is also selected according to iOS locale. 0) Tooltip will be shown when hovering on the linked component: String: text: Tooltip displayed text: String: type: Tooltip type: Real: ui_enum_variants. You can add this package to your project using Swift Package Manager. width. 15, then create empty NSView and use as overlay. I followed the instructions listed on the AzureAD github to register your app within the Azure Portal. 3 Handling User Input. The app can open PNG/JPEG images, scroll and magnify by using pinch-in/out gestures. Contribute to wan-dada/swift-swiftui-example development by creating an account on GitHub. isEnabled adds the tooltip but will not display. Think when adding tooltips, you could override an existing gesture without you knowing. plist. 0, 6. Updated on May 10, 2023. In this repository we are collecting our solutions to interesting SwiftUI problems that we encounter when developing our apps. Contribute to nrikiji/swiftui-app-example development by creating an account on GitHub. roundedBorder) Important: If you’re using Xcode 12 you need to use RoundedBorderTextFieldStyle() rather than . zero. Although inspired by Objective-C and many other languages, Swift is not itself a C-derived language. Optionally, you can include an image to associate with the tip. - quisido/react-mui-tooltip You signed in with another tab or window. main. Aug 2, 2020 · 8. And the API design is to stay the same as the original SwiftUI API as possible. Contains official SwiftUI control examples and some custom controls - jayzhou27/SwiftUIControls. While the overlay adds itself as a child of the current window (to be on top of everything), the CoachMarksController will add itself as a child of the view controller you provide. Features include: Optional dialog title. This is an example project that builds an app adopting SwiftUI Document-Based App architecture. You will need to have your own backend ready and add your stripe key to the app delegate and the custom backend url in MYApiClient file. SwiftUI-MVVM. Currently, this project is in early development. Contributing to previous versions. SimpleToDo is a to do list editor. struct Tooltip: NSViewRepresentable {. TouchBar - TODO. 10 Creating a macOS App. Swift 100. } Use case: the main view has an automatically refreshing view model for foo and creates many static view models for it's A tag already exists with the provided branch name. You will most likely supply self to start. 0+ SwiftUI Tooltip . When wrapping the Trigger in a custom Tooltip component, as described here: Radix Docs, the data-state attribute is overwritten by the Tooltips Aug 13, 2012 · Template iOS app using Clean Architecture and MVVM. The ForEach being used here is purposefully named to match the one in SwiftUI, because it serves a similar purpose, but we're using MacMenuBar. var body : some View {. Dec 1, 2019 · In swiftUI 2: Toggle("", isOn: $isOn) . Solve issue when you select an item and release it (to cancel) and view is not reset. Rough attempt at creating a container view that lays out its children in a circle. 2 Building Lists and Navigation. Enter following url when adding it to your project package dependencies: To associate your repository with the swiftui-components topic, visit your repo's landing page and select "manage topics. Circle Blinking Lines. Highly customizable but also keeping your code highly reusable via a composable structure. toolTip = tooltip. A featureless app trying to replicate iOS's swipe-to-return navigation. Three Rotating Dot. This is an example iOS project using Stripe with SwiftUI. For detailed information about implementation checkout article 1, article 2 & article 3. This repo a 100% SwiftUI app showcasing examples of navigation, Multiplatform support & deep linking using the new NavigationStack & NavigationSplitView API's based of my course that that showcases everything you need to know about handling navigation in SwiftUI apps Custom views (UIView or SwiftUI View) Written in Swift, compatible for Obj-C! Please open a Github issue, if you think anything is missing or wrong. import { Tooltip } from 'react-tooltip'. Once you have your Swift package set up, adding AxisTooltip as a dependency is as easy as adding it to the dependencies value of your Package. You can study the code and project structure to better understand the principles of Clean Swift. self ) . Here's some examples of the possibilities (the pill style is the default): Full-Width styles in action (the pill styles support the same features / animations): SwiftUI Tooltip . Dec 1, 2023 · For example, when you display a List that animates its changes, you do not want to see an animation for the initial state of the list, or to prevent this undesired animation with extra code. Getting started. TooltipView is a view in SwiftUI. let view = NSView () Feb 13, 2022 · The Swift Package Manager is a tool for automating the distribution of Swift code and is integrated into the swift compiler. objects SwiftUI Tooltip . Chat - Chat UI framework with fully customizable message cells, input view, and a built-in media picker. This repository demonstrates an example of using Clean Swift Architecture for app development. 此项目已上架到Apple商店. A library that displays tooltips in the desired view. 🙇. Hi everyone, I have a problem when using the Tooltip together with the Collapsible Trigger. See the animation below for more details. let tooltip: String. Animatable Cards - Examples projects using SwiftUI & Combine to animatable cards; swiftui-notes - A collection of notes, project pieces, playgrounds and ideas on learning and using SwiftUI and Combine. " GitHub is where people build software. ) Features. It has a clean and modern syntax, offers seamless access to existing C and Objective-C code and frameworks, and is memory-safe by default. There are warnings in the project made which will remind you. serif) You can also set the available date range. Right now there are just four projects available, but more will be added in time: SimpleNews is a news reader. 0) Change files. or yr ma pv nj ck fd nj oc ic